Training Course
DWDM Infrastructure Basics
13-14 September 2025
Icon

Certificate: Certified DWDM Infrastructure Specialist (CDIS)

An introductory course designed for professionals who are beginning to work with DWDM technologies or seeking to systematize their knowledge. The program covers the fundamental principles of wavelength-division multiplexing, the structure of DWDM networks, the basics of Optical Transport Network (OTN), as well as architectural approaches to designing hybrid DWDM infrastructure that integrates optical and radio-frequency (microwave and millimetre-wave) communication channels with traffic redundancy.

Program

  • Fundamentals of DWDM Technology
  • Principles of Wavelength Division Multiplexing (CWDM/DWDM)
  • Components of DWDM Systems
  • Introduction to OTN Architecture
  • Basic Topologies and Design Approaches
  • Microwave DWDM Channels: Operating Principles and Frequency Ranges
  • Hybrid Optical-Radio Channels: Use Cases and Design Principles
  • Traffic Redundancy and Switching (1+1, Ring, NMS/SDN)

Certification
Upon course completion, participants take a final assessment. Successful results grant the Certified DWDM Infrastructure Specialist (CDIS) certificate, which confirms foundational qualification in the design of DWDM networks, including both optical and radio-frequency transport segments.

Training Course (Advanced)
DWDM Systems Architecture - Advanced
25-26 October 2025
Icon

Certificate: Certified DWDM Systems Architect (CDSA)

Designed for professionals working with high-load DWDM systems. The course program covers the design and optimization of network solutions using ROADM, as well as integration with MPLS and IP networks. Special emphasis is placed on building scalable, high-speed network architectures and designing hybrid DWDM infrastructure with microwave coverage, including channel redundancy and dispatching.

Program

  • Modern Methods for Designing DWDM Systems
  • ROADM Principles and Design
  • Integration of DWDM with MPLS and IP Networks
  • Performance Management and System Scalability
  • Network Traffic Optimization and Fault Tolerance
  • Design of Hybrid Optical-Microwave Backbones (MW/μW)
  • Channel Redundancy and Dispatching (NMS, SDN, ASON)

Certification
Upon course completion, participants take a final assessment. The CDSA certificate confirms expert-level qualification in DWDM network design, including optical and microwave transport channels with redundancy and dispatching mechanisms.
